Pin to program the EOL comparator.
It is possible to select both the EOL sensing method (fixed reference or
reference in tracking with CTR) and the window comparator amplitude by
connecting a resistor (R
Input for the window comparator.
It can be used to detect lamp ageing for either “lamp to ground” or “block
capacitor to ground” configurations.
This function is blanked during the ignition phase.
Input pin for:
- PFC over-voltage detection: the PFC driver is stopped until the voltage returns
in the proper operating range
- Feedback disconnection detection
- Reference for EOL comparator (in case tracking reference)
- The pin can be used also for shutdown
Multiplier external input. This pin is connected to the rectified mains voltage via a
voltage divider and provides the sinusoidal reference to the PFC current loop.
Output of the error amplifier. A compensation network is placed between this pin
and INV to achieve stability of the PFC voltage control loop and ensure high
power factor and low THD.
Inverting input of the error amplifier. Output voltage of the PFC pre-regulator is
fed to the pin through a voltage divider.
Boost inductor demagnetization sensing input for PFC transition-mode
operation. A negative-going edge triggers PFC MOSFET turn-on.
During startup or when the voltage is not high enough to arm the internal
comparator, the PFC driver is triggered by means of an internal starter.
Input to the PFC PWM comparator. The current flowing through the PFC
MOSFET is sensed through a resistor. The resulting voltage is applied to this pin
and compared with an internal sinusoidal-shaped reference, generated by the
multiplier, to determine the PFC MOSFET’ s turnoff.
A second comparison level detects abnormal currents (due to boost inductor
saturation, for example) and, on this occurrence, shuts down the PFC gate.
An internal LEB prevents undesired function triggering.
